MEMORANDUM
To:      Members, Florida House of Representatives
From:  Speaker Larry Cretul
Date:   June 26, 2009
Re:      Complaint 09-01 regarding Representative Ray Sansom

As you know, I appointed D. Stephen Kahn as the special investigator to review a citizen's complaint filed with the House regarding Representative Sansom.  I am writing to inform you that Mr. Kahn has issued the attached Statement of Alleged Violation. 
 
When a special investigator issues a Statement of Alleged Violation, House Rule 16.2 requires the Speaker to appoint a Select Committee on Standards of Official Conduct.  In compliance with that Rule, I hereby appoint the following members to serve on the Select Committee:
 
Representative Bill Galvano, Chair
Representative Faye Culp
Representative Joe Gibbons
Representative Rich Glorioso
Representative Ari Porth
 
In conducting its review, the Select Committee will follow the process and procedures specified by House Rule 16.2.  Please be advised that while the proceedings of the Select Committee are underway, except when acting in an official capacity, members of the Select Committee are prohibited by the Rule from commenting upon or discussing with any other person the matters that occasioned the appointment of the Select Committee.
